Sinopsis

A Literary Memoir by the author. The world is at war. England has just entered WWII and Germany is determined to punish her. The English government has decided to protect her children by sending them out of the cities. This story is about the author and her family. It is told by the youngest daughter from the time she is four and six years later when the war ends and she is ten. It is a story that will entertain, educate and touch you and one that you will not soon forget.
